This provision discloses a novel and specific situational awareness capability finding in which Gemini 3.1 Pro achieved near-complete success on challenges related to max tokens, context size modification, and oversight frequency, which are operationally relevant to AI alignment research, governance assessments, and regulatory evaluations of advanced AI systems. The finding that these specific challenges were solved for the first time by this model is a material disclosure for AI safety governance purposes.
Interpretive note: The operational significance of the three specific situational awareness challenges (max tokens, context size mod, oversight frequency) depends on AI safety research context that is not fully elaborated in this model card, creating some interpretive uncertainty about the practical implications of these findings.

Compare across platforms →"On situational awareness, the model is stronger than Gemini 3 Pro: on three challenges which no other model has been able to consistently solve, max tokens, context size mod, and oversight frequency, the model achieves a success rate of almost 100%. However, its performance on other challenges is inconsistent, and thus the model does not reach the alert threshold.Excerpt from Google Gemini's Gemini 3.1 Pro Model Card
(1) REGULATORY LANDSCAPE: The misalignment and situational awareness disclosure engages emerging AI governance frameworks including the EU AI Act's requirements for systemic risk assessment of general-purpose AI models with high capability thresholds.
